Trains from London Blackfriars (BFR) to Cuxton station (CUX) run on average 16 times per day, taking around 1h 22m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at £28 if you book in advance.

The earliest train runs at 05:06, the last at 23:37. The fastest train covers the 42 km distance in 57m.

Accessibility
Accessibility
  • Staff help available: No
  • Step free access coverage: No
  • Step free access note: Category B1. This station has a degree of step-free access to the platform, which may be in both directions or in one direction only - please check details - Step free access to platform for services to Strood. Step free access for services to Paddock Wood via car park Step free interchange between platforms via level crossing. Unstaffed station. Ramp for train access and staff to assist, are on the trains.
  • Accessible public telephones: Public telephones are not wheelchair accessible
  • Accessible taxis: Accessible taxis are available to book
  •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station
  • Accessible ticket machines note: by entrance to platform 1
  • Ramp for train access: Yes
  • Wheelchairs available: No
  •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No

Public transport options for Cuxton
  • Location for Rail Replacement Services: Towards Maidstone: Bus stop on Sundridge Hill, opposite Bush Road. Towards Strood: Bus stop on Sundridge Hill, opposite the White Horse pub
